攜程阿波羅(Apollo) https://www.cnblogs.com/xiaxiaolu/p/10025597.html 一、瞎扯點什么 1.1 阿波羅 阿波羅是希臘神話中的光明之神、文藝之神,同時也是羅馬神話中的太陽神;他是光明之神,從不說謊,光明磊落,在其身上找不到黑暗 ...
一 背景 最近公司訂單中心重構,利用spring boot集成apollo配置中心,因此學習一下apollo配置中心 因為如今程序功能越來越復雜,程序的配置日益增多:各種功能的開關 參數配置 服務器地址 數據庫鏈接等對於配置的期望值越來越高:配置修改后實時生效 灰度發布 分環境 分集群管理配置 完善的權限 審核機制等。 所以傳統的配置文件越來越無法滿足開發人員的需求。所以就有了apollo 二 A ...
2018-08-03 11:19 0 4948 推薦指數:
攜程阿波羅(Apollo) https://www.cnblogs.com/xiaxiaolu/p/10025597.html 一、瞎扯點什么 1.1 阿波羅 阿波羅是希臘神話中的光明之神、文藝之神,同時也是羅馬神話中的太陽神;他是光明之神,從不說謊,光明磊落,在其身上找不到黑暗 ...
說明:很遺憾,如果是使用0.8.0Release版的,默認不能登錄,只有寫死一個apollo的用戶。 實現登錄: 1、先通過官方教程了解用戶管理的原理:https://github.com/ctripcorp/apollo/wiki/Portal-%E5%AE%9E%E7%8E%B0%E7 ...
Apollo是配置管理系統,會提供權限管理(Authorization),理論上是不負責用戶登錄認證功能的實現(Authentication)。所以Apollo定義了一些SPI用來解耦,Apollo接入登錄的關鍵就是實現這些SPI。 實現登錄: 1、先通過官方教程了解用戶管理的原理:https ...
說明: 1、Spring Boot項目默認使用logback進行日志管理 2、logback在啟動時默認會自動檢查是否有logback.xml文件,如果有時會有限加載這個文件。 3、那么如果是用配置中心的配置方法,那么必須要阻止logback.xml文件的先加載 ...
官網:https://github.com/ctripcorp/apollo Wiki:https://github.com/ctripcorp/apollo/wiki(一切的集成方式和使用方法都在這里) Issues:https://github.com/ctripcorp/apollo ...
Apollo(阿波羅)是攜程框架部門研發的配置管理平台,能夠集中化管理應用不同環境、不同集群的配置,配置修改后能夠實時推送到應用端,並且具備規范的權限、流程治理等特性。服務端基於Spring Boot和Spring Cloud開發,打包后可以直接運行,不需要額外安裝Tomcat等應用容器。Java ...
Apollo上新建App和相關的配置項,可以參考如下配置: 在Nuget上引入Com.Ctrip.Fram ...
前提:先搭建好本地的單機運行項目:http://www.cnblogs.com/EasonJim/p/7643630.html 說明:下面的示例是基於Spring Boot搭建的,對於Spring項目基本通用。遷移舊項目的配置下一篇說明,這里先就如何快速的集成Client和獲取配置的值進行實踐 ...